long last! Stuart Gordon's From Beyond on DVD
It’s
been a long time coming, but finally director Stuart Gordon’s
the little known gem of a film ‘From Beyond’ is
to get a release on (but with the worst damn cover, which
we are trying our best to ignore) DVD as an unrated Director's
cut. Best known to horror buffs as the filmmaker behind the
gory H.P. Lovecraft adaptation, "Re-Animator"
(1985), Gordon's second released feature, "From Beyond"
(1986), was less well know. Another irreverent take on Lovecraft,
the atmospheric monster movie was less mad cap than his first
feature, but still had imagination aplenty.
Synopsis:"
Dr. Pretorius and his colleagues are working on a sensational
experiment: by means of stimulation of the pineal gland, they
want to open the human mind to higher dimensions. When the
experiment succeeds, however, they are immediately attacked
by terrible life forms, which apparently are floating around
us unseen. When Dr. Pretorius is killed by one of them, Dr.
Tillinghast is suspected of murder and thrown into a psycho
ward due to his stories. Only the ambitious psychologist Dr.
McMichaels believes him and wants to continue the experiment."

Hong
Kong horror 'The Closet' now on DVD
Francis
Ng has shown his versatility in numerous Hong Kong movies,
from the insane guy in Crazy 'N the City to the suave hitman
in Exiled. In the horror 'The Closet,' Ng portrays a traumatized
magician who feels haunted by his late father in a quiet house.
Directed by Dick Tso (Those were the Days and Love Cruise),
the film also stars Eddie Cheung (Election), TV starlet Michelle
Yip, plus new Mainland actress Daisy Yang.
Synopsis:"
As a child, magician Fei (Francis Ng) was violently abused
by his father, and he is particularly traumatized by the memory
of being locked in a closet. Haunted by his childhood nightmare,
Fei almost loses his life in a dangerous magic show. His girlfriend
(Daisy Yang), without knowing his history, thinks that he
is just too tired and takes him to the countryside for rest.
They move into a quiet house, where Fei often feels his dead
father's presence..."
